Ceinsys Tech Reports ₹96 Crore Profit and ₹999 Crore Order Book Ahead of NSE Listing

Ceinsys Tech Ltd. has announced strong financial results for the first nine months of FY26, reporting a Profit After Tax (PAT) of ₹963 million (₹96.3 crore). The company also highlighted its substantial order book, valued at ₹9,990 million (₹999 crore) as of December 31, 2025. These figures provide a solid foundation as the company looks to leverage its recent listing on the National Stock Exchange (NSE).

Financial Highlights

For the nine-month period ending FY26, Ceinsys Tech achieved operational revenue of ₹4,900 million (₹490 crore). The reported Profit After Tax (PAT) stood at ₹963 million (₹96.3 crore). This performance was underpinned by a robust order book totaling ₹9,990 million (₹999 crore) by the close of December 2025. The company officially listed on the NSE on February 19, 2026, shortly after this reporting period.

Company History

With a 27-year track record, Ceinsys Tech has developed deep expertise in Geospatial, Mobility, and Emerging Technology sectors. Its growth strategy focuses on integrating technologies such as GIS, AI, ML, IoT, and digital twins, complemented by its established focus on government projects. The listing on the NSE on February 19, 2026, marks a key step in its market presence expansion.

Competitive Environment

Ceinsys Tech competes in the geospatial solutions space with companies like Genesys International Corporation Ltd. Broader IT firms engaged in digital transformation and serving government sectors, such as Coforge Ltd. and Tata Elxsi Ltd., also operate in related technology service domains.
